About the Food and Beverage Manager role:
As our Food and Beverage Manager, you will be a key member of the location management team, reporting directly to the General Manager. You will oversee the operation of our Forest Retreat, ensuring smooth operations and exceptional service. Open all year-round, the Forest Retreat serves as a reception, shop, and café, providing a welcoming space for our guests. Unlike other hospitality jobs, we provide a better work/life balance than most hotels or bars. Our opening hours are location dependent, but with morning shifts starting no earlier than 8am and evening shifts finishing by 9pm, we offer a different experience of working in hospitality. Who Are Forest Holidays?
We’re a Certified B Corp, recognised as a force for good. Our holidays are good for people and the planet. We’re a team of 800, stewards of 244.5 hectares of forest, managing the land for conservation and creating beautiful spaces for people to stay. Our tucked-away cabin locations are thoughtfully placed to let guests discover the wonders of nature and embrace the Forest Feeling.
